Abstract

The utility model discloses a kind of intelligent interconnection fault electric arc electrical fire-detectors, including rear shell and objective box, the inside of the rear shell offers threaded hole in two sides up and down, the objective box is located at the front end of rear shell, and the inside circumference of objective box offers limiting slot, wiring entrance is offered on the left of the objective box, the inside left end of the objective box is equipped with current sensor, and operational amplifier is connected with above current sensor, data converter is connected on the right side of the operational amplifier, the lower right side of the central processing unit is connected with GPRS chip, and the upper right side of central processing unit is connected with leakage switch, the rear of the rear shell is connected with support rod, the front end of the objective box is connected with front housing, and the front end of front housing pastes and is connected with rubber ring.The intelligent interconnection fault electric arc electrical fire-detector facilitates and is mounted on the wall installation detector, has the function of shatter-resistant, easy to disassemble, effectively to the internal heat dissipating of objective box.

Compared with prior art, the utility model has the beneficial effects that the intelligent interconnection fault electric arc electrical fire detects Device facilitates and is mounted on the wall installation detector, has the function of shatter-resistant, easy to disassemble, effectively dissipates to the inside of objective box Heat;
1. being provided with rear shell, rear surface makes rear of the heat inside objective box from rear shell in the rear shell of Openworks shape structure It sheds, and when the intelligent interconnection fault electric arc electrical fire-detector is mounted on the wall, longitudinal section is in concave-shaped structure energy The contact area of rear shell and wall is enough reduced, the two sides up and down of rear shell offer threaded hole, are convenient for by threaded hole by the intelligence Fault electric arc electrical fire-detector can be interconnected to be mounted on wall;
2. being provided with protecting box and rubber ring, the inside spaced set of protecting box has spring, and it is mutual to can reduce the intelligence The vibration that connection fault electric arc electrical fire-detector generates when dropping, rubber ring are pasted onto the front end of front housing, front housing and rubber ring Concave-shaped structure is constituted, front housing is avoided to be broken;
3. being provided with objective box, objective box is inlayed with rear shell to be connect, and objective box is connect with front housing card slot, is convenient for rear shell It is removed from objective box with front housing, the inside of objective box is repaired.
4. being provided with support rod, support rod has 4 groups about the center line symmetrical setting of rear shell, and the longitudinal section of support rod is in " T " font structure, can intelligent interconnection fault electric arc electrical fire-detector be stable is placed on working face by this.

Working principle: when using the intelligent interconnection fault electric arc electrical fire-detector, wiring is entered from wiring first Mouth 7 accesses on the current sensor 9 of the model pcm in objective boxes 5, and the electric current of wiring carries out in 9 pairs of current sensor work Detection, the operational amplifier 10 of model TL082 follow detection, current information are passed to the data conversion of model 264-016 Device 11 converts electrical signals to digital information, and data converter 11 is connect with central processing unit 12,12 butted line of central processing unit The course of work is controlled, and GPRS chip 13 connects extraneous GPRS module, and current signal is passed to remote control equipment, works as hair When calamity of lighting a fire, the alarm 14 of model SS-168 is alarmed, and leakage switch 18 protects circuit, avoids bigger loss, When needing to repair the intelligent interconnection fault electric arc electrical fire-detector, company is inlayed using objective box 5 and rear shell 1 Connect, objective box 5 is connect with the card slot of front housing 16, rear shell 1 and front housing 16 are removed from objective box 5, to the inside of objective box 5 into Row maintenance utilizes about 1 two sides of rear shell when needing to install the intelligent interconnection fault electric arc electrical fire-detector on metope Threaded hole 2 is fixed the intelligent interconnection fault electric arc electrical fire-detector with metope using screw, when needing that the intelligence is mutual Joining fault electric arc electrical fire-detector to place at work, support rod 15 is mounted in rear shell 1 in the way of threaded connection, The support rod 15 of 4 groups of " T " font structures by the intelligent interconnection fault electric arc electrical fire-detector it is stable be placed on working face On, the sequence of operations of the intelligent interconnection fault electric arc electrical fire-detector will be just completed above, is not made in this explanation in detail The content of description belongs to the prior art well known to professional and technical personnel in the field.
